To diagnose noisy plumbing, it is important to determine initial whether the undesirable noises happen on the system's inlet side-in other words, when water is turned on-or on the drain side. Sounds on the inlet side have actually differed causes: excessive water pressure, used shutoff as well as faucet parts, improperly attached pumps or various other home appliances, improperly placed pipe bolts, as well as plumbing runs consisting of too many tight bends or various other limitations. Noises on the drainpipe side normally come from poor area or, similar to some inlet side noise, a layout containing limited bends.
Hissing
Hissing noise that occurs when a tap is opened somewhat typically signals too much water stress. Consult your regional water company if you believe this issue; it will have the ability to tell you the water pressure in your location as well as can install a pressurereducing shutoff on the incoming water pipeline if required.
Various Other Inlet Side Noises
Squeaking, squeaking, damaging, snapping, and also tapping usually are brought on by the growth or tightening of pipes, generally copper ones providing hot water. The audios happen as the pipelines slide against loosened fasteners or strike nearby home framing. You can commonly pinpoint the place of the problem if the pipelines are exposed; simply follow the noise when the pipes are making sounds. Most likely you will uncover a loose pipeline hanger or a location where pipes exist so close to floor joists or various other framing items that they clatter against them. Connecting foam pipe insulation around the pipes at the point of call ought to treat the problem. Make certain straps as well as wall mounts are protected and also provide appropriate assistance. Where possible, pipeline bolts ought to be connected to massive structural aspects such as structure walls instead of to framing; doing so minimizes the transmission of resonances from plumbing to surface areas that can amplify and move them. If affixing fasteners to framing is unavoidable, wrap pipes with insulation or various other resistant product where they speak to bolts, and sandwich the ends of new fasteners between rubber washers when installing them.
Fixing plumbing runs that deal with flow-restricting tight or various bends is a last option that ought to be embarked on just after seeking advice from a skilled plumbing contractor. Unfortunately, this scenario is rather usual in older residences that might not have actually been developed with indoor plumbing or that have seen several remodels, especially by amateurs.
Chattering or Shrilling
Extreme chattering or shrilling that takes place when a shutoff or faucet is turned on, and that usually goes away when the installation is opened completely, signals loose or faulty internal parts. The remedy is to change the shutoff or faucet with a new one.
Pumps and also devices such as cleaning devices and dishwashers can move electric motor noise to pipes if they are improperly linked. Link such items to plumbing with plastic or rubber hoses-never rigid pipe-to isolate them.
Drain Sound
On the drainpipe side of plumbing, the principal objectives are to get rid of surfaces that can be struck by falling or rushing water and also to shield pipelines to consist of inevitable sounds.
In new construction, bath tubs, shower stalls, toilets, and wallmounted sinks and also containers must be set on or against resilient underlayments to reduce the transmission of audio via them. Water-saving bathrooms as well as faucets are much less loud than traditional models; mount them as opposed to older kinds even if codes in your location still permit using older components.
Drains that do not run vertically to the cellar or that branch into straight pipe runs supported at floor joists or other mounting present specifically problematic sound issues. Such pipes are big enough to emit considerable resonance; they additionally carry substantial amounts of water, that makes the situation even worse. In new building, specify cast-iron soil pipelines (the big pipelines that drain pipes toilets) if you can manage them. Their massiveness consists of much of the noise made by water travelling through them. Likewise, stay clear of routing drains in walls shown rooms and areas where people gather. Wall surfaces containing drainpipes need to be soundproofed as was described previously, making use of double panels of sound-insulating fiber board and also wallboard. Pipes themselves can be covered with unique fiberglass insulation made for the function; such pipelines have an impervious plastic skin (occasionally including lead). Outcomes are not constantly acceptable.
Thudding
Thudding noise, usually accompanied by shuddering pipes, when a tap or device valve is shut off is a problem called water hammer. The sound and vibration are triggered by the resounding wave of stress in the water, which instantly has no place to go. In some cases opening up a shutoff that releases water quickly right into a section of piping containing a limitation, arm joint, or tee installation can generate the same condition.
Water hammer can typically be treated by setting up installations called air chambers or shock absorbers in the plumbing to which the trouble shutoffs or faucets are connected. These devices allow the shock wave produced by the halted circulation of water to dissipate airborne they consist of, which (unlike water) is compressible.
Older plumbing systems might have brief upright areas of capped pipeline behind wall surfaces on tap competes the same purpose; these can eventually fill with water, decreasing or destroying their efficiency. The remedy is to drain the water system completely by turning off the primary supply of water valve as well as opening all taps. After that open up the major supply shutoff and also shut the taps one by one, beginning with the tap nearest the shutoff as well as ending with the one farthest away.
WHY IS MY PLUMBING MAKING SO MUCH NOISE?
This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.
To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.
You’ll want to turn off your home’s water supply, then open ALL faucets (from the bathroom sink to outdoor hose bib) to drain your pipes. Then, turn the water back on and hopefully the noise stops! If you’re still hearing the sound, give us a call to examine further.

Cracks or Ticks
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.
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.
Bangs
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
